Well, we shall leave it at that. But the story is, socialite Shalita Namuyimba aka Bad Black will be out of Luzira sometime mid next month. She is in the final days of her four-year jail sentence which she received after being found guilty of embezzling money from her British lover, David Greenhalgh.
Bad Black was sentenced along with former lover- socialite Meddie Ssentongo, who was handed a shorter sentence.

We have heard that Bad Black intends to stage a procession with tens of luxurious cars and many of her female friends to escort her from Luzira to the city centre. We are yet to confirm with police if they received info about such a public procession.
